Projekt

Allgemein

Profil

« Zurück | Weiter » 

Revision 9ff21697

Von Moritz Bunkus vor etwa 7 Jahren hinzugefügt

  • ID 9ff216979ee746cfa216483016c81e77edff682c
  • Vorgänger fec48603
  • Nachfolger 5313b0e8

common/flash.html via INCLUDE und nicht PROCESS einbinden

flash.html überschreibt mehrere Variablen mit eigenen Werten: `title`,
`type` und `messages`. Wird das Template also mit `PROCESS`
eingebunden, so findet keine Lokalisierung statt, und die Werte aus
`flash.html` gelten dann plötzlich auch für das Template, das
`flash.html` eingebunden hat.

Unterschiede anzeigen:

templates/webpages/dunning/search.html
3 3
[%- USE L %][%- USE P -%]
4 4
<h1>[% title %]</h1>
5 5

  
6
[% PROCESS 'common/flash.html' %]
6
[% INCLUDE 'common/flash.html' %]
7 7

  
8 8
 <form method="post" name="search" action="dn.pl" id="form">
9 9

  

Auch abrufbar als: Unified diff